{-# LANGUAGE CPP #-} {-# LANGUAGE ConstraintKinds #-} {-# LANGUAGE FlexibleContexts #-} {-# LANGUAGE FlexibleInstances #-} {-# LANGUAGE InstanceSigs #-} {-# LANGUAGE MultiParamTypeClasses #-} {-# LANGUAGE RankNTypes #-} {-# LANGUAGE UndecidableInstances #-} -- XXX -- | -- Module : Streamly.Streams.Prelude -- Copyright : (c) 2017 Harendra Kumar -- -- License : BSD3 -- Maintainer : harendra.kumar@gmail.com -- Stability : experimental -- Portability : GHC -- -- module Streamly.Streams.Prelude ( -- * Fold Utilities foldWith , foldMapWith , forEachWith ) where import Streamly.Streams.StreamK (IsStream(..)) import qualified Streamly.Streams.StreamK as K ------------------------------------------------------------------------------ -- Fold Utilities ------------------------------------------------------------------------------ -- | A variant of 'Data.Foldable.fold' that allows you to fold a 'Foldable' -- container of streams using the specified stream sum operation. -- -- @foldWith 'async' $ map return [1..3]@ -- -- @since 0.1.0 {-# INLINABLE foldWith #-} foldWith :: (IsStream t, Foldable f) => (t m a -> t m a -> t m a) -> f (t m a) -> t m a foldWith f = foldr f K.nil -- | A variant of 'foldMap' that allows you to map a monadic streaming action -- on a 'Foldable' container and then fold it using the specified stream sum -- operation. -- -- @foldMapWith 'async' return [1..3]@ -- -- @since 0.1.0 {-# INLINABLE foldMapWith #-} foldMapWith :: (IsStream t, Foldable f) => (t m b -> t m b -> t m b) -> (a -> t m b) -> f a -> t m b foldMapWith f g = foldr (f . g) K.nil -- | Like 'foldMapWith' but with the last two arguments reversed i.e. the -- monadic streaming function is the last argument. -- -- @since 0.1.0 {-# INLINABLE forEachWith #-} forEachWith :: (IsStream t, Foldable f) => (t m b -> t m b -> t m b) -> f a -> (a -> t m b) -> t m b forEachWith f xs g = foldr (f . g) K.nil xs
